Nowadays, lots of laptop have a sealed battery for performance reasons. I would like to know if it is the case on 15-ab278nf as well. Is the battery easily removable and changeable ?

 

Thank you for your support !


Your notebook has a 4-cell, 41 Wh Li-ion battery, which is located at the rear/bottom of the notebok and can be removed easily using the sliding latch on the bottom of the notebook.
